There were only four states that did not have an earthquake between the years 1975 and 1995. These states are Wisconsin, North Dakota, Florida, and Iowa. Southern California averages about 10,000 earthquakes per year, but most of them are so small, no one notices.

Alaska has 12,000 earthquakes per year, California 10,000. Alaska is the state with the most earthquakes, California second and Hawaii third.
All of the states have experienced earthquakes in the past. However Alaska, Hawaii, Nevada, Washington and Idaho are the most active states besides California.
Florida has experienced numerous earthquakes throughout its history, but they are generally quite mild, resulting in little damage or injuries. The link below gives you a history of recorded Florida earthquakes.
